Output 8b7aeb94b82a73e2a2375137aa258ed59c11a9142535fab4a1c20a50bdb2085f:16

value
43661543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fd1a1ca85bd0855d1e51e254ca2c139e3f80cea OP_EQUALVERIFY OP_CHECKSIG
address
16pShaAUkvM4p8Jz9K5bKvV9FWFPN3yRvE
transaction
8b7aeb94b82a73e2a2375137aa258ed59c11a9142535fab4a1c20a50bdb2085f
spent
true